@ -0,0 +1,45 @@
mod cargo_workspace;
mod sysroot;
use std::path::{Path, PathBuf};
use failure::bail;
pub use crate::{
cargo_workspace::{CargoWorkspace, Package, Target, TargetKind},
sysroot::Sysroot,
};
// TODO use own error enum?
pub type Result<T> = ::std::result::Result<T, ::failure::Error>;
#[derive(Debug, Clone)]
pub struct ProjectWorkspace {
pub cargo: CargoWorkspace,
pub sysroot: Sysroot,
}
impl ProjectWorkspace {
pub fn discover(path: &Path) -> Result<ProjectWorkspace> {
let cargo_toml = find_cargo_toml(path)?;
let cargo = CargoWorkspace::from_cargo_metadata(&cargo_toml)?;
let sysroot = Sysroot::discover(&cargo_toml)?;
let res = ProjectWorkspace { cargo, sysroot };
Ok(res)
}
}
fn find_cargo_toml(path: &Path) -> Result<PathBuf> {
if path.ends_with("Cargo.toml") {
return Ok(path.to_path_buf());
}
let mut curr = Some(path);
while let Some(path) = curr {
let candidate = path.join("Cargo.toml");
if candidate.exists() {
return Ok(candidate);
}
curr = path.parent();
}
bail!("can't find Cargo.toml at {}", path.display())
}
